Job Description

The Indian Curry Chef will be responsible for preparing and cooking authentic Indian dishes to a consistently high standard, with particular responsibility for traditional curries, sauces, gravies and associated dishes. The chef will work closely with the Head Chef and kitchen team to ensure efficient kitchen operations, food quality, hygiene and consistency.

Requirements
  • Prepare and cook a wide range of authentic Indian curries, sauces, gravies and speciality dishes according to established recipes and restaurant standards.
  • Demonstrate expertise in Indian spices, herbs, marinades and traditional cooking techniques to maintain authentic flavours and consistency.
  • Prepare meat, poultry, seafood, vegetables, lentils and other ingredients required for curry and main-course dishes.
  • Ensure consistent food quality, taste, presentation and portion control across all dishes.
  • Coordinate with the Head Chef and other kitchen staff to ensure orders are prepared accurately and delivered within required service times.
  • Assist with menu planning, development of new dishes, seasonal specials and improvements to existing recipes.
  • Monitor ingredient and stock levels, assist with ordering and ensure appropriate stock rotation to minimise food waste and control costs.
  • Maintain appropriate food storage, temperature controls, labelling and handling procedures in accordance with food safety requirements.
  • Follow all food hygiene, HACCP, allergen management, health and safety and cleaning procedures.
  • Maintain a clean, organised and hygienic workstation, kitchen equipment and food preparation areas.
  • Support the training and development of junior kitchen staff in Indian cooking methods, recipes, portion control and food safety procedures.
  • Work efficiently during busy service periods while maintaining high standards of food quality and presentation.
  • Ensure appropriate management of allergens and prevent cross-contamination during food preparation.
  • Report equipment faults, stock shortages, food-quality concerns and other operational issues to the Head Chef or Restaurant Manager.
  • Contribute to the efficient operation of the kitchen and help maintain MOKSHA's standards for authentic Indian cuisine and customer satisfaction.
